Review
The Yamaha YZF-R1 2003 is a legendary sportbike that continues to be highly sought after by motorcycle enthusiasts for its exceptional performance and cutting-edge technology. With a powerful 998cc engine delivering exhilarating acceleration and top-notch handling, the YZF-R1 offers riders a thrilling experience on both the street and the track. Its aggressive styling, lightweight frame, and advanced suspension system contribute to its impressive agility and responsiveness, making it a top choice for riders looking to push the limits of speed and precision. Despite being nearly two decades old, the Yamaha YZF-R1 2003 still holds its own against newer models thanks to its timeless design and innovative features. Riders can expect a versatile and reliable machine that offers a perfect balance of power, control, and comfort for both short rides and long journeys. Whether you're a seasoned rider looking for a high-performance sportbike or a newcomer eager to experience the thrill of riding a true racing machine, the Yamaha YZF-R1 2003 remains a solid investment that delivers exceptional value and performance.

Pros (Advantages)

✅ Why buy this bike?

  • The Yamaha YZF-R1 2003 is equipped with a powerful 998cc inline-four engine that delivers exceptional performance and acceleration.
  • It features a lightweight and agile chassis, making it easy to handle and maneuver through corners.
  • The bike's sleek and aggressive design not only looks great but also enhances aerodynamics for improved performance.
  • The YZF-R1 2003 is known for its advanced suspension system, providing a smooth and responsive ride even on rough roads.
  • With its reputation for reliability and durability, the Yamaha YZF-R1 2003 is a solid choice for both track enthusiasts and street riders.
👎
Cons (Disadvantages)

⚠️ Things to consider

  • The 2003 Yamaha YZF-R1 has a reputation for having a stiff and uncomfortable ride, especially on longer journeys.
  • The fuel efficiency of the 2003 YZF-R1 is not the best, requiring frequent stops for refueling on longer rides.
  • Some riders have reported issues with the stock suspension on the 2003 YZF-R1, requiring upgrades for better performance.
  • The aggressive riding position of the 2003 YZF-R1 may not be suitable for all riders, causing discomfort and fatigue during extended rides.
  • The 2003 model year of the Yamaha YZF-R1 lacks some of the advanced electronic features and rider aids found in more modern sportbikes, impacting overall performance and rider experience.
